Quote:A couple of weeks ago, I reviewed the Asetek WaterChill cooling kit. This water-
cooling kit contained both CPU cooling, GPU cooling and chipset cooling, and as
far as I could see, there wasn’t anything missing. Asetek, however, found one
more piece in your computer to cool, and today I am reviewing the Asetek HD
Cooler. Yes, you read right. Asetek has released a cooling block for hard
drives, allowing you to lower the temperature of your hot running drives.
